Transcriptional Repressor Protein Based Macrolide Biosensor Development With Improved Sensitivity, Jayani A. Christopher Jan 2021

Transcriptional Repressor Protein Based Macrolide Biosensor Development With Improved Sensitivity, Jayani A. Christopher

Graduate Research Posters

Macrolide antibiotics are in high demand for clinical applications. Macrolides are biosynthesized via giant assembly line polyketide synthases (PKS) which are arranged in a modular fashion. Combinatorial biosynthetic methods have been used to produce diversified macrolides by reprograming these modules and modifying tailoring enzymes required for post synthetic modifications. However it is challenging due to the size and complexity of PKSs. To overcome this challenge, new enzymes for macrolide diversification could be obtained by directed evolution where a large number of enzyme variants need to be screened. Principal Components Analysis Corrects Collider Bias In Polygenic Risk Score Effect Size Estimation, Nathaniel S. Thomas, Peter B. Barr, Fazil Aliev, Sally I. Kuo, Danielle M. Dick, Jessica E. Salvatore Jan 2021

Principal Components Analysis Corrects Collider Bias In Polygenic Risk Score Effect Size Estimation, Nathaniel S. Thomas, Peter B. Barr, Fazil Aliev, Sally I. Kuo, Danielle M. Dick, Jessica E. Salvatore

Graduate Research Posters

BACKGROUND: Genome-wide polygenic scoring has emerged as a way to predict psychiatric and behavioral outcomes and identify environments that promote the expression of genetic risks. An increasing number of studies demonstrate that the effects of polygenic risk scores (PRS) may be biased by the inclusion of heritable environments as covariates when the environment is influenced by unmeasured confounding variables, an example of collider bias. Inclusion of the principal components of observed confounders as covariates may correct for the effect of unmeasured confounders.

Vasculogenic Mimicry: Role Of Melanoma Differentiation Associated Gene-9/Syntenin, Jinkal Modi, Anjan Pradhan, Luni Emdad, Swadesh Das, Paul Fisher Jan 2021

Vasculogenic Mimicry: Role Of Melanoma Differentiation Associated Gene-9/Syntenin, Jinkal Modi, Anjan Pradhan, Luni Emdad, Swadesh Das, Paul Fisher

Graduate Research Posters

Malignant melanoma (MM) is the most aggressive skin cancer and the most frequent skin disorder in Caucasians. MM is associated with aggressive and progressive disease states, leading to major cancer-related morbidity and mortality. Recent investigations identify a new non-angiogenesis-dependent pathway vasculogenic mimicry (VM), which is considered a cancer hallmark that can independently facilitate tumor neovascularization by the formation of fluid-conducting and vascular endothelial cells. MM cells undergoing VM can dedifferentiate into numerous cellular phenotypes and acquire endothelial-like features, resulting in the formation of the de novo matrix-rich vascular-like network, such as plasma and red blood cells. Pharmacogenomics And Ssris Appropriateness In Older Community Dwelling African Americans, Wint War Phyo, Lana Sargent, Elvin T. Price Jan 2021

Pharmacogenomics And Ssris Appropriateness In Older Community Dwelling African Americans, Wint War Phyo, Lana Sargent, Elvin T. Price

Graduate Research Posters

Background: Depressive and anxiety disorders are among the most common illnesses experienced by older adults (age > 60). The selective serotonin reuptake inhibitors (SSRIs) are preferred class of antidepressants for these disorders due to their high efficacy and safety profiles among older adults. However, SSRIs are metabolized by highly polymorphic cytochrome P450 enzymes, specifically CYP2D6 and CYP2C19. This can lead to variable dose-response outcomes, especially among older African American population.

Activity Of Saccharomyces Cerevisiae By Single Entity Electrochemistry, John Lutkenhaus Jan 2021

Activity Of Saccharomyces Cerevisiae By Single Entity Electrochemistry, John Lutkenhaus

Graduate Research Posters

According to the Centers of Disease Control and Prevention, antibiotics decrease in effectiveness as bacteria gain resistance for previously treatable illnesses. Currently, antibiotic susceptibility is typically carried out via the Kirby-Bauer method. Even with automation, this process requires two incubation periods so a less time-consuming technique is desirable. Single entity electrochemistry (SEE) detects changes in current when collisions of individual particles at an ultramicroelectrode (UME) are linked with an electrochemical event. Post-Mortem Brain Nuclei Isolation for Single Nucleus RNA Sequencing

Charles Tran, Dept. of Biology, with Dr. Karolina Aberg, VCU School of Pharmacy

When tissue samples are studied in bulk without consideration for different cell proportions and types, results can be biased due to the attenuation of unique cellular expressions. In order to study cell type specific RNA expression profiles within tissue, single cell RNA sequencing (scRNA-seq) is used. For scRNA-seq studies it is critical to have intact cells.
